This is your opportunity to become a vital part of the UK's largest private healthcare provider, specialists in complex care, with hospitals rated outstanding by the CQC. We are actively recruiting for anEHR Digital Programme Change Management Lead.

It is a hugely exciting time for our organization.We are pioneers in providing healthcare solutions to our patients as part of an established US healthcare organization built on over 50 years of experience.To continue our success, we are implementing our five-year One HCA UK strategy, which includes ambitious growth plans, the opening of new sites and significant investments in enhancing effectiveness and alignment as a group.

These growth plans include implementing a real time end-to-end Electronic Health Record (EHR) platform, a multi-million-pound investment, and part of our long-term digital transformation initiative. Focused on advancing our technology and integrating web-based navigation, this EHR will allow HCA UK clinicians and colleagues to enhance patient safety, quality and care and to maintain our outstanding ratings and continue to be a global market leader in complex care. Therefore, we are investing in a new workforce to lead this change, and we are actively recruiting now for a 2023 start, focused on change management, transforming work practices, and project delivery of goals and objectives.

In summary

This a fantastic opportunity for an experienced leader, you will be part of a leadership team which willembark on a division-wide transformational. This programme includes multiple workstreams across the business and you will be responsible for the oversight and management of all the change leads across the programme , ensuring best practice and consistency, providing an assurance of the business change management delivery, defining change management frameworks, tools and methodologies .

You will be leading on the change management activities required to support the implementation of the new EHR systems/technologies and related processes , en suring the change management plans at a workstream level are aligned, pulling together a programme wide change management plan to be delivered across HCA UK .
